My initial research led to me producing a 76 page booklet in A5 format that i hoped would be seen to be an updated & far more detailed account of the village in the Great War. PURTON, VILLAGE SONS & THE GREAT WAR was printed in April and so far i have sold 107 copies around the village, Swindon area and as far away as Canada. ALL proceeds are being donated to The Royal British Legion (Registered Charity 219279), copies are available through Rick from In Touch services in the village priced at £5, or you can use this page to purchase a copy using PAYPAL.
